标签: azure azure-functions
我有一个azure函数应用程序(abc.azurewebsites.net),并在其中定义了一个名为Function1的函数。 (abc.azurewebsites.net/api/Function1?code=def ==)
有没有一种方法可以将Function1定义为默认值,并将所有传入abc.azurewebsites.net的请求路由到我的Function1?
谢谢。
答案 0 :(得分:1)
您可以使用proxy来获取。
按照本教程操作,Route template应该为/,然后应该像this一样将函数authLevel更改为anonymous。
Route template
/
authLevel
anonymous
1。设置应用程序设置,将值HELLO_HOST添加到<YourBackendApp>.azurewebsites.net(与后端url相同的任何参数)。
HELLO_HOST
<YourBackendApp>.azurewebsites.net
2。创建代理。
3。将函数设置为anonymous,则您的函数不需要API密钥代码即可调用它。
然后在我的测试结果下方,这是一个带有查询字符串&name=<yourname>的HTTP触发函数。
&name=<yourname>